How Do Compressed Schedules Affect a Commercial AV Installation?

We live in an increasingly rapid-paced society—even speed limits have increased up to 80 mph in some areas. But speed is not always the smartest option. And when it comes to commercial AV projects, ‘fast’ does not lead to high-quality results.

Often, we need to pump the brakes and evaluate the consequences of moving too quickly. We’ve all heard the ‘Fast, Good, and Affordable’ theory—that you can only have two. Most people believe if a service is affordable and good, it won’t be fast. If it’s affordable and fast, it won’t be good. And if it’s fast and good, the service won’t be affordable. 

So, what’s the best choice for a commercial AV installation? What kind of business should you partner with if you’re looking for a new technology system? As an integrator that services the Prosper, TX, area, we’ll share the best course of action below.
